Motivation for this change

Currently limited size pstores eventually fill up and logs of any panics stop being saved, making it harder to diagnose them. This enables the systemd-pstore service, which frees them automatically and adds them to the journal.

Design

We can't mount /sys/fs/pstore with the other special file systems, because at that time the kernel hasn't loaded the pstore module yet.
systemd cannot mount virtual file systems that expose APIs, so we can't use a mount unit.
Instead we just create a very simple systemd service that does the job.

On systems without pstore I expect the modprobe service to fail, which doesn't look nice in the journal, but I'm not aware of a good alternative.

Left for another time is making usage of the EFI variable pstore optional, which it currently is not even without this PR (this one just adds the vacuuming instead of only dumping into it).

It definitely isn't because systemd is already mounting pstore, because that line has not just been part of systemd for 8 years, it also doesn't have an effect on NixOS - which is why we have a separate stanza in one of those files for reimplementing that part of systemd in NixOS, from which /sys/fs/pstore is missing.
On my system, /sys/fs/pstore is not mounted without this PR, and I am now upgrading it to unstable to see if something goes wrong specifically during activation (attempting to start it twice maybe?).
If that's not the case, something else must be mounting /sys/fs/pstore and we need to find out what it is, because it's only present for a subset of users. One way to do so would be to start running auditd early in the boot.

Finally have some time to poke at this. It appears that /sys/fs/pstore will automatically be mounted if pstore is built into the kernel (CONFIG_PSTORE=y) or it's loaded prior to /sys being mounted the first time (in stage 1, boot.kernelModules are loaded after the special filesystems are mounted).

The machine I initially encountered the on-boot failure is an aarch64 host running a custom kernel with CONFIG_PSTORE=y. With mount-pstore disabled:

[root@serotina:~]# uname -a
Linux serotina 5.12.5 #1-NixOS SMP Tue Jan 1 00:00:00 UTC 1980 aarch64 GNU/Linux

[root@serotina:~]# systemctl status mount-pstore
● mount-pstore.service
     Loaded: masked (Reason: Unit mount-pstore.service is masked.)
     Active: inactive (dead)

[root@serotina:~]# mount | grep pstore
pstore on /sys/fs/pstore type pstore (rw,nosuid,nodev,noexec,relatime)

[root@serotina:~]# zcat /proc/config.gz | grep CONFIG_PSTORE=
CONFIG_PSTORE=y

On the regular kernel, pstore is built as a module:

[root@malus:~]# uname -a
Linux malus 5.10.37 #1-NixOS SMP Fri May 14 07:50:46 UTC 2021 x86_64 GNU/Linux

[root@malus:~]# systemctl status mount-pstore
● mount-pstore.service
     Loaded: masked (Reason: Unit mount-pstore.service is masked.)
     Active: inactive (dead)

[root@malus:~]# mount | grep pstore

[root@malus:~]# zcat /proc/config.gz | grep CONFIG_PSTORE=
CONFIG_PSTORE=m

[root@malus:~]# lsmod | grep pstore
efi_pstore             16384  0
pstore                 28672  1 efi_pstore

On a machine with CONFIG_PSTORE=y, I used an audit rule to trace all mount syscalls:

Audit configurations
{
  boot.kernelParams = [ "audit=1" "audit_backlog_limit=500" ];
  security.audit = {
    enable = true;
    rules = [
      "-a exit,always -S mount"
    ];
  };
  security.auditd.enable = true;
  # Add rule before systemd starts
  boot.initrd.postDeviceCommands = ''
    ${pkgs.audit}/bin/auditctl -a exit,always -S mount
  '';
}

Looking at the audit logs I couldn't find a call that specifically mounted /sys/fs/pstore so I don't think it's coming from userspace. If I modify stage 1 and nixos/modules/tasks/filesystems.nix to mount /sys after boot.kernelModules are loaded, /sys/fs/pstore is automatically mounted.

However, this doesn't explain why the initial activation will cause the failure. Remounting /sys after pstore is loaded doesn't appear to automatically mount /sys/fs/pstore, so we're missing something here.
